Mac-specific OS installers can invariably be tricked into installing their pay load 
anyway!

You do not run the standard "Install Mac OS" application that's on the main level of 
the HD.

Instead, you have to dig deep into the installers folder and find the Mac OS 8.0 
installer. Run the 8.0 installer. Then, from the web, download the (free) 8.1 
installer and run it. IIRC the 8.1 installer on the Mac-specific CDs is the 
computer-specific. The same work around has worked for me with 8.5 and 9.0 in a pinch.

Any other things you want installed (like QuickTime update, Text to Speech, etc.) you 
will have to run manually from the installers folder.

 That's probably your problem. The error message you're getting I have seen 
 when I tried to use a backed-up 9.0 install disk (pesky users physically 
 cracking CDs! Grrr....). You may find you have more luck if you identify 
 where in the install process it's dying, instead doing a custom installation 
 and skipping that portion of the install (Whatever it's referencing in the 
 "Installing xxxx......").
